What is The Witcher: Blood Origin about?

The Witcher: Blood Origin is a prequel miniseries that spends four hours explaining how witchers came to exist in the world of Netflix's flagship fantasy show. If you watched the main series and found yourself curious about the deep lore, this is marketed directly at you, though it turns out that's a smaller group than Netflix hoped.

The show follows a ragtag band of elves and misfits who band together to fight the Deathless Mother, a force threatening their world. It's a straightforward assembly-narrative played mostly straight, with sword work and magic and betrayals you can see coming. The tone sits somewhere between grimdark fantasy and adventure romp without fully committing to either. There are moments of genuine charm, particularly around the chemistry of the central cast, but the writing leans heavily on exposition and world-building mechanics that feel more like fan service than story. Michelle Yeoh appears as a mysterious narrator figure, which should feel momentous but mostly makes you wish the show had given her more to do.

Critics and audiences were largely indifferent to dismissive. It holds a 5/10 on IMDb, and the general sentiment suggested that viewers either came in deep on Witcher lore and still found it thin, or didn't care about the mythology in the first place. The four-episode length means it never builds real momentum, and the finale resolves its central conflict but barely touches the "why witchers matter" question that justified its existence.

It exists in the crowded space of prestige-network fantasy prequels that have mostly failed to justify themselves in the last few years. Blood Origin takes its world-building seriously, which is admirable, but it mistakes explaining things for making them matter to anyone watching.

Why did The Witcher: Blood Origin end?

The Witcher: Blood Origin arrived as a limited prequel series, not as an open-ended show expecting renewal. Netflix released all four episodes on Christmas Day 2022, treating it as a self-contained story set thousands of years before the events of The Witcher proper. The show was always designed to stand alone, telling the origin of the witchers as a one-off narrative rather than launching an ongoing franchise.

The series faced immediate audience indifference. Its IMDb rating of 5/10 reflects viewer disappointment, and the show failed to generate the cultural momentum Netflix likely hoped for when attaching the Witcher name to it. For a prequel spinoff with modest episode count and modest reception, there was no business case for continuation. Viewers who sampled it were not clamouring for more, and the main Witcher series itself was already facing its own challenges with audience retention and cast turnover.

Netflix's strategy with Blood Origin appears to have been to test whether the Witcher universe could sustain multiple stories. The answer, based on reception and engagement, was no. The streamer moved on. There was no cancellation here because nothing was promised beyond those four episodes, but the show's inability to find an audience made it clear that further investment in Witcher spinoffs was unwise.
